Ohio's weather demands a durable roof. Winters bring snow and ice, which can cause weight damage and leaks. Spring and fall can bring heavy rains. Summer storms sometimes include high winds and hail. This cycle means roofs are constantly under pressure. Regular inspections help catch problems before they worsen.
In Ohio, avoid shingles that can't handle cold temperatures and ice buildup. Materials that become brittle in winter or degrade quickly in the sun are not ideal. Look for shingles rated for wind and freeze-thaw cycles. We help Cleveland homeowners choose wisely.
